The Roomba S9+

The s9+ is a high-end robotic vacuum that can be used as a mop. Its suite is built into an elegant new design. It cleans around corners and along edges. It also maps your home and self-empties.

The s9+ is equipped with powerful motors that offer 40X more suction3 than previous Irobots. It can also detect carpeted surfaces and trigger Power Boost to deep clean. Its automatic dirt recognition is very precise and can identify the smallest toy or dust particle from one another, preventing the toy from becoming stuck.

Once the s9+ has become full of debris, it automatically returns to its dock and empty itself by forcefully sucking the contents into its huge bin. This process, which sounds like a jet engine taking off, only takes about a minute and can be scheduled through the Irobot app.

The Roomba J9+

The j9+ robot vacuum and mop from iRobot is the most powerful combination of robots. It's designed to thoroughly clean larger homes and those with pets. It has a 3-stage cleaning system as well as two rubber brushes that are excellent for debris pickup. It also comes with Carpet Boost Technology that lifts dirt and pet hair that is embedded and to remove deeper carpeting. Its Dirt Detective feature analyzes data from previous cleaning efforts in order to identify and prioritize areas that are dirty. It then adjusts settings such as suction power and scrub intensity to give those areas the attention they deserve.

The Roomba j9+ is compatible with iRobot Braava jet M6 and can be used to mop up after robot vacuums. It is compatible with Amazon Echo devices and other smart home systems. It can be controlled via voice commands. It has a 1-year limited manufacturer's warranty.

One thing that sets the j9+ apart from other cleaners is its ability to empty and refill its own tank. It comes with a water tank and a dispenser that is controlled by a robot. It can refill itself automatically when the dustbin is full. This is a significant time saver since you don't need to worry about changing the dirty water or emptying the bin.

When you purchase the j9+ it comes with a clean base and dock as well as a set extra filters, an extra side brush and an virtual wall. It's important to place the dock or base in a place that's easy for the robot to reach and is away from walls, furniture cabinets, and other obstructions. The iRobot website recommends a spot with four feet of clearance in front, 1.5 feet of clearance on each side, and four feet between the base and any stairs.

The j9+ was extremely effective in cleaning bare floors and picking up pet hair and crumbs, and small particles. However, it struggles with larger particles and tends to shut off its cleaning process when the dust bin is full. The j9+’s Dirt Detective can also be inconsistent. It often throttles suction to conserve power, even if an area needs more attention.

The Braava jet M6

The Braava jet m6 is iRobot's most advanced mopping robot, capable of clean large and multiple spaces exactly like a human. It makes use of Precision Jet spray to get rid of grime and sticky messes and kitchen grease, requiring less effort on your part. Smart Navigation helps it navigate your space with safety and avoid danger. It also comes with a cliff detection feature which stops it from falling down steep drops or stairwells.

The m6 can also learn your home while it mops, thanks to Imprint Smart Mapping Technology. After cleaning a room or multiple rooms a few times, it will produce an image that you can view within the app and customize with labels. Once you've labeled the rooms, you can direct the m6 to clean specific rooms or the entire home on the days you decide.

You can control the m6 with the iRobot App for Android and iOS or voice commands from your compatible Amazon Alexa device or Google Assistant device. You can also set up a cleaning schedule, create "keep out zones," and much more using the app. The m6 is also designed to fit into corners that are tight and under furniture, making it easier to keep your space clean.

The m6 comes with a cleaning base, a washable wool mop pad two disposable paper-towelling pads the iRobot sample bottle of hard floor cleaning solution and a battery pack. It is available in black or white and retails for $399 on the internet. The m6 also qualifies for iRobot’s 3-year limited warranty.
